The relationship of sexual abuse to symptom levels in emotionally disturbed girls
Authors:Ferol E. Mennen DSW  Diane Meadow Ph.D.
Affiliation:(1) School of Social Work, University of Southern California, University Park, MC0411 Los Angeles, CA, 90089-0411;(2) Private Practice in Laguna Nigue, CA
Abstract:This research study examined symptom levels and sexual abuse status of emotionally disturbed girls in residential treatment. Sexually abused girls had poorer self esteem, higher levels of anxiety, and a trend toward more depression than the nonabused girls on self-report measures.
